Variable analysis
- Antibody used for immunostaining (anti-HCN4, anti-DNAJB6, anti-TBX3)
- Signal intensity from DNAJB6 and TBX3 antibodies immunostaining
- Mouse SAN tissue samples
- Tissue freezing medium
- Cryostat sectioning at 10 μm
- Immunostaining protocol (as described in Sun et al., 2009)
- Microscope and imaging software (Zeiss Axioplan II with ApoTome and AxioVision or Zeiss LSM 780 confocal microscope)
- No positive or negative controls were explicitly mentioned in the provided information.
